Influence of Nitrogen Sources and Application Methods on Growth and Yield of Soybean [Glycine max (L.) Merrill]

Abstract

A field experiment was conducted during the kharif season of 2019 in the research farm of college of Agriculture, Central Agricultural University, Imphal to study the Influence of Nitrogen Sources and Application Methods on Growth and Yield of soybean {Glycine max (L.) Merrill}. The treatments comprised of four Nitrogen sources [N1(75%N Urea+25%N FYM), N2(75%N Urea+25%N poultry manure), N3(75%N Urea+25%N Vermi compost), and N4(100%N Urea)] and two Application methods[M1(Soil incorporation), M2(Band placement)] Which were laid out in Factorial Randomized Design (FRBD) with eight treatment combinations and replicated thrice. Among Nitrogen sources all growth parameters, yield attributes and yield were performed well under N2 (75%N Urea+25%N Poultry manure) followed by N3(75%N Urea+25%N Vermi compost). While lowest values were found under N1 (75%N Urea+25%N FYM). Between two application methods M2 (Band placement) performed better. Among various growth parameters plant height, number of branches/plant, dry matter accumulation/plant were noticed maximum with the 75%N Urea+25%N Poultry manure applied in band placement method (N2M2). Similarly, Number of pods/plant, grain yield (q/ha), straw yield (q/ha) and harvest index(%) were noticed maximum with same treatment combination N2M2. Similarly gross returns and net returns was found best in N2M2.
